Scott Douglas Robbe (February 16, 1955 – November 21, 2021) was an American film, television, and theater producer/director, and veteran activist. He was a prominent founding member of both ACT UP and Queer Nation.

Nov 26, 2021 · Scott Robbe, an early and important member of ACT UP and Queer Nation and a founder of other activist groups, died on November 21 in hospice care in his sister’s home in Wisconsin after a year-long battle with myelodysplastic anemia, a form of blood cancer.
